E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ases an exquisite engraving of clove spice from the year 1855. Taken from the renowned book "A History of the Vegetable Kingdom" by William Rhind, this vertical, color image transports us back to a time when botanical illustrations were meticulously crafted by hand. The engraving, created through a delicate process of etching and lithography, captures the essence of this aromatic plant with remarkable precision. The chromolithograph reveals every intricate detail of the clove flower and its seed, offering a glimpse into nature's beauty as perceived over a century ago. This antique piece serves as both an educational tool and a testament to human fascination with spices throughout history.
